#955577 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#955577 is composed of 58.4% red, 33.3%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 328.1 degrees, a saturation of 27.4% and a lightness of 45.9%. #955577 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aee with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#955577 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#955577 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#955577 has RGB values of R:149, G:85,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.2,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9786743.

Shades and Tints of #955577

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0709 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
